When Bitcoin (BTC) launched in 2009, it was motivated by the mistrust of economic establishments and their charges and the inflationary practices by central banks in the course of the Nice Recession. Bitcoin was speculated to usher in an period of decentralization, monetary inclusion and democratization. 

But greater than a decade later, with Bitcoin costs surging, we’re witnessing the digital asset being hoarded by giant, centralized monetary establishments, risking the ideas behind its creation. Bitcoin is now in peril of being predominantly within the area of the financially included — precisely the forms of establishments that the creators sought to keep away from within the first place.

Skepticism of the mainstream

As an entrepreneur who was round for the final technological disruption of the web, I performed a job in one of many web’s most dominant classes: social networks. As a co-founder of LinkedIn, I’m struck by an identical form of idealism that pervaded the Web 1.zero period, however I additionally see the chasm between these on this new artwork and those that have but to expertise its advantages and query its existence.

Crypto and blockchain stay of their infancy a few years after their creation. There are some lots of of tens of millions of Bitcoin and Ether (ETH) wallets, whereas the web boasts 4.7 billion customers. Even underneath an optimistic assumption of 250 million wallets and one consumer per pockets, crypto’s consumer base represents solely 5% of web customers. The latest ascendancy of crypto’s market cap to $1 trillion is just one% of the worldwide public inventory markets’ whole market cap, which stands at $90 trillion. Most blockchain tasks right now nonetheless have woefully restricted adoption, and their tokens are topic to unstable hypothesis.

Except Bitcoin, which is lastly being endorsed by the consultants, and decentralized finance, which in its present speculative state has the potential to reveal real-world worth, this neighborhood is aware of its justifiable share of skeptics. The mainstream nonetheless wonders whether or not crypto and blockchain are options seeking an issue when centralized options appear to be working simply superb at scale. The trade nonetheless has not captured the creativeness of the mainstream nor proven indicators of mass adoption.

Attraction to mainstream audiences, not simply fanatics

As an trade, we have to work on options that enchantment to the mainstream, with a concentrate on functions or decentralized functions. We must always determine the functions earlier than investing an excessive amount of extra in infrastructure tasks that abound within the ecosystem.

Immediately the world’s high firms present functions for end-users and aren’t infrastructure suppliers. Check out the highest 50 web firms: Nearly all of them supply options to a big addressable market of customers which have huge energetic consumer bases. What’s extra, for those providing infrastructure options, they began by bringing functions to market first. Solely after these functions achieved some type of scale did these firms supply infrastructure instruments. Probably the most notable examples embody Amazon and Amazon Internet Companies (in 1994 and 2006, respectively), Fb and Fb Platform (in 2004 and 2007), Google and Google Cloud (in 1998 and 2008), and LinkedIn and Confluent (in 2003 and 2014).
